Essential Strumming Patterns Quarter Notes (example: “Boulevard of Broken Dreams” by Green Day) The intro to “Boulevard of Broken Dreams” consists of only ÂŒ notes (albeit with some assistance from a delay pedal). With two quarter notes per chord, the song moves quickly through the progression despite the spacious strumming pattern.

About the developer.Sep 9, 2023 · Ukulele Strumming Pattern 1: D-D-D-D. This is probably one of the first strumming patterns that everybody learns on the ukulele, and it’s pretty simple. All you have to do is strum down across all the strings, bring your hand back up to the top of the strings, and strum down again. It’s great for adding emphasis to each beat in a 4-beat ...

Feb 8, 2019 · Similarly, an upwards arrow indicates that you should strum upwards. Notice that the pattern starts with a downstroke, and ends with an upstroke. So, if you were to play the pattern twice in a row, your hand wouldn't have to vary from its continual down-up motion. Now, try playing the pattern, taking special care to "keeping the rhythm". Tips for practicing strumming patterns. 1. At first, try playing a single chord over all beats until you have mastered the patterns ( try with a C chord first). Then gradually substitute different chords in over each beat. Try the I IV IV vii chords of a key for example C, F, G and A chords. Developing a quick but light stroke is really an important part of creating a pleasant strum sound. To develop this skill, work on one stroke at a time. Try this: Fret a chord, then move your strum hand downward across the strings as lightly and quickly as you can. 4. Balance the Volume. Apply the light and fast idea to the upstroke as well.
